First, we need to check our input method and language settings. In Windows, follow these steps:

  1. Click the language bar in the lower right corner of the screen and select Language Preferences.
  2. Enter the language interface and ensure that Chinese (Simplified) or Chinese (Traditional) has been added.
  3. Click the options button to check whether the default input method is Microsoft Pinyin or other Chinese input methods.
  4. If there is no problem with the above settings, you can try switching to other input methods for testing to confirm whether it is a problem with the input method itself.

Option 2: Use the system’s own input method to call up symbols

If you still cannot input Chinese punctuation marks after checking the input method and language settings, you can try the following methods:

  1. Switch to Chinese input method.
  2. At the location where you need to enter punctuation marks, press the Shift+Space key combination.
  3. A symbol selection box will appear, and you can select the required punctuation marks to insert.
  4. This method can solve the problem of being unable to input Chinese punctuation marks in Word.
